Statute of Limitations
The statute of limitation limits the time that a victim can pursue a lawsuit following an accident. It is a legal principle that protects the victim by ensuring only meritorious cases are brought to court. The timeframe for bringing a case is determined by the type of legal claim or crime that is involved. Following a car crash for instance, the victim may have only two years to file a personal injury lawsuit against the party responsible.
If the case isn't filed within this time frame it is likely it will be tossed out of court. It is because it can be hard for victims to remember all the details of the accident after a long period of time. It isn't easy to collect all the evidence within this time frame.

Limitation laws are enforced by every state and differ based on jurisdiction. For instance, in Texas victims have two years from the date of their accident to make a claim. It's not that they can't file after the two-year period. However, if they do so, the defendant could respond with a motion to strike in the event that there was an excessive amount of delay.
There are, however, some exceptions to the statute of limitations. If the victim is in a coma due to serious brain trauma, the statute of limitation can be extended until the patient is fully healed. Other limited exceptions include legal disability, discovery rule and continuing tort doctrine.
